THE GRAND TEMPLE AT FREEMASONS’ HALL WAS THE VENUE FOR THE SECOND ORGAN CONCERT OF THE YEAR, ON 5 AUGUST 2021. The concert, given by renowned organist D’Arcy Trinkwon, was be a celebration of the summer season and the easing of Covid-19 restrictions and was held at Freemasons’ Hall. While enjoying the concert, visitors were able to marvel at the magnificent Willis pipe organ, which resides in the Grand Temple of Freemasons' Hall in London, an Art Deco masterpiece completed in 1933. Mr Trinkwon is one of the outstanding organists of his generation, acclaimed for his artistic mastery and virtuoso fervour in the service of his art. Having performed in international festivals and concert series in halls, cathedrals and churches around the world, his engagements include recording, broadcasts, masterclasses, teaching and concerto performances – most recently with the Manchester Camerata, the Royal Northern Sinfonia and the Hove Symphony orchestras. For the occasion at Freemasons’ Hall, the organist selected many wonderful pieces including: Overture to the Overture ‘St Paul’, Felix Mendelssohn (1809-1847), arranged by W T Best (1826-1897); Concert Variations on the Austrian Hymn, Op.3, John Knowles Paine (1839-1906); Symphony in C minor, Op.47: II. Scherzo, Frederick Holloway (1873-1954); Sonata Eroïca, Op.94, Joseph Jongen (1873-1953); Pastorale, Jean Jules Roger-Duccasse (1873-1954); and Studio da Concerto sopra la melodia gregoriana del ‘Salve Regina’, Raffaele Manari (1887-1933).
